Former Tennessee DB Rashaan Gaulden was a Round 3 pick in the 2018 NFL Draft, going to the Carolina Panthers.
He spent the 2018 season and part of the 2019 season with the Panthers before signing with the New York Giants at the end of the 2019 season.
Earlier this year, he had tryouts with the Pittsburgh Steelers and Tennessee Titans before he ended up with a new team on Monday. As you can see below, Gaulden has signed with the Las Vegas Raiders and will be a member of their practice squad:

The Raiders are firmly in the playoff race, so it’ll be interesting to see if Gaulden makes an impact before the year is over.
With the COVID-19 pandemic, teams have to have plenty of players ready to go at a moment’s notice this year.
